Basavanagudi is a residential and commercial locality in the Indian city of Bengaluru.
Basavanagudi is one of the oldest localities of Bangalore evidenced by the fact that it is home to four inscriptions, three Kannada and one Tamil and also one of the poshest areas of Bangalore.
[2][3][4] It is located in South Bangalore, along the borders of Jayanagar and Lalbagh Botanical Gardens.
[5] The main commercial street in Basavanagudi is DVG Road, which is home to numerous retail businesses - several of them dating back to the 1920s and 1930s.
Towards the middle of DVG Road is Gandhi Bazaar, known for its market which sells fresh flowers, fruits, and vegetables.
